WebAclStatementArgsBuilder

Functions

Link copied to clipboard
@JvmName(name = "jlddmtjsfrtaoqvh")
suspend fun andStatement(value: WebAclAndStatementArgs?)
@JvmName(name = "omurnsuypxgbhiew")
suspend fun andStatement(value: Output<WebAclAndStatementArgs>)
@JvmName(name = "ogoyysyxlkyvteax")
suspend fun andStatement(argument: suspend WebAclAndStatementArgsBuilder.() -> Unit)
Link copied to clipboard
@JvmName(name = "vimuygnhptcwfbru")
suspend fun byteMatchStatement(value: WebAclByteMatchStatementArgs?)
@JvmName(name = "hygvhtktcwdasdxp")
suspend fun byteMatchStatement(value: Output<WebAclByteMatchStatementArgs>)
@JvmName(name = "fvsdovfbohcckqdq")
suspend fun byteMatchStatement(argument: suspend WebAclByteMatchStatementArgsBuilder.() -> Unit)
Link copied to clipboard
@JvmName(name = "cldyswaisijmevvd")
suspend fun geoMatchStatement(value: WebAclGeoMatchStatementArgs?)
@JvmName(name = "rggejpolghcnwnbv")
suspend fun geoMatchStatement(value: Output<WebAclGeoMatchStatementArgs>)
@JvmName(name = "onkswfykpsymvnme")
suspend fun geoMatchStatement(argument: suspend WebAclGeoMatchStatementArgsBuilder.() -> Unit)
Link copied to clipboard
@JvmName(name = "ixajanjfqgttclkh")
suspend fun ipSetReferenceStatement(value: WebAclIpSetReferenceStatementArgs?)
@JvmName(name = "qvmpntrhboalqunp")
suspend fun ipSetReferenceStatement(value: Output<WebAclIpSetReferenceStatementArgs>)
@JvmName(name = "jddemskmlevdyvqt")
suspend fun ipSetReferenceStatement(argument: suspend WebAclIpSetReferenceStatementArgsBuilder.() -> Unit)
Link copied to clipboard
@JvmName(name = "doxyeqkbepsocwda")
suspend fun labelMatchStatement(value: WebAclLabelMatchStatementArgs?)
@JvmName(name = "mrvgpyocuiikbsdy")
suspend fun labelMatchStatement(value: Output<WebAclLabelMatchStatementArgs>)
@JvmName(name = "xknguqluknwhclfe")
suspend fun labelMatchStatement(argument: suspend WebAclLabelMatchStatementArgsBuilder.() -> Unit)
Link copied to clipboard
@JvmName(name = "hcifrsburljuaylv")
suspend fun managedRuleGroupStatement(value: WebAclManagedRuleGroupStatementArgs?)
@JvmName(name = "xcxrmvojsqqcnigl")
suspend fun managedRuleGroupStatement(value: Output<WebAclManagedRuleGroupStatementArgs>)
@JvmName(name = "rotmrgqstayoahix")
suspend fun managedRuleGroupStatement(argument: suspend WebAclManagedRuleGroupStatementArgsBuilder.() -> Unit)
Link copied to clipboard
@JvmName(name = "bmvkfsguhgjkvrpf")
suspend fun notStatement(value: WebAclNotStatementArgs?)
@JvmName(name = "oorbemyeqruiygmf")
suspend fun notStatement(value: Output<WebAclNotStatementArgs>)
@JvmName(name = "ktpwmhuokgsaaflu")
suspend fun notStatement(argument: suspend WebAclNotStatementArgsBuilder.() -> Unit)
Link copied to clipboard
@JvmName(name = "vahbrvydwckbqixy")
suspend fun orStatement(value: WebAclOrStatementArgs?)
@JvmName(name = "lmrdemykibntxqld")
suspend fun orStatement(value: Output<WebAclOrStatementArgs>)
@JvmName(name = "msshroplmcbetqmn")
suspend fun orStatement(argument: suspend WebAclOrStatementArgsBuilder.() -> Unit)
Link copied to clipboard
@JvmName(name = "jehqahhetqyrchgp")
suspend fun rateBasedStatement(value: WebAclRateBasedStatementArgs?)
@JvmName(name = "vhmpsxbqgkcphyal")
suspend fun rateBasedStatement(value: Output<WebAclRateBasedStatementArgs>)
@JvmName(name = "yeddyeikrjrxgpuj")
suspend fun rateBasedStatement(argument: suspend WebAclRateBasedStatementArgsBuilder.() -> Unit)
Link copied to clipboard
@JvmName(name = "oityrwrdlpoheyaa")
suspend fun regexMatchStatement(value: WebAclRegexMatchStatementArgs?)
@JvmName(name = "ojnfqkkvpdmupkpf")
suspend fun regexMatchStatement(value: Output<WebAclRegexMatchStatementArgs>)
@JvmName(name = "setsrgqoumkqghvf")
suspend fun regexMatchStatement(argument: suspend WebAclRegexMatchStatementArgsBuilder.() -> Unit)
Link copied to clipboard
@JvmName(name = "apxwuuvmopddrecq")
suspend fun regexPatternSetReferenceStatement(value: Output<WebAclRegexPatternSetReferenceStatementArgs>)
@JvmName(name = "vmijwlfbbxkjindb")
suspend fun regexPatternSetReferenceStatement(argument: suspend WebAclRegexPatternSetReferenceStatementArgsBuilder.() -> Unit)
Link copied to clipboard
@JvmName(name = "rheiesoihifqlwph")
suspend fun ruleGroupReferenceStatement(value: WebAclRuleGroupReferenceStatementArgs?)
@JvmName(name = "fuesxgjdaddogxdd")
suspend fun ruleGroupReferenceStatement(value: Output<WebAclRuleGroupReferenceStatementArgs>)
@JvmName(name = "wraxvrnyihgxrvke")
suspend fun ruleGroupReferenceStatement(argument: suspend WebAclRuleGroupReferenceStatementArgsBuilder.() -> Unit)
Link copied to clipboard
@JvmName(name = "mlqskyyfspxvytne")
suspend fun sizeConstraintStatement(value: WebAclSizeConstraintStatementArgs?)
@JvmName(name = "dflktviwudxbbigr")
suspend fun sizeConstraintStatement(value: Output<WebAclSizeConstraintStatementArgs>)
@JvmName(name = "dggkmgyhaytuchsv")
suspend fun sizeConstraintStatement(argument: suspend WebAclSizeConstraintStatementArgsBuilder.() -> Unit)
Link copied to clipboard
@JvmName(name = "kghkhsilaubbbmyn")
suspend fun sqliMatchStatement(value: WebAclSqliMatchStatementArgs?)
@JvmName(name = "lhhbkubqvfvkwwms")
suspend fun sqliMatchStatement(value: Output<WebAclSqliMatchStatementArgs>)
@JvmName(name = "lrhaubwjdttmsaiy")
suspend fun sqliMatchStatement(argument: suspend WebAclSqliMatchStatementArgsBuilder.() -> Unit)
Link copied to clipboard
@JvmName(name = "hghdrofbfntwkinh")
suspend fun xssMatchStatement(value: WebAclXssMatchStatementArgs?)
@JvmName(name = "sfhiganywxllpwms")
suspend fun xssMatchStatement(value: Output<WebAclXssMatchStatementArgs>)
@JvmName(name = "vpxslqcgqlavgrne")
suspend fun xssMatchStatement(argument: suspend WebAclXssMatchStatementArgsBuilder.() -> Unit)